Elected to the Georgia House of Representatives in 2010, State Representative Bruce Williamson currently serves as a member of the following House committees: Banks & Banking; Energy, Utilities, & Telecommunications; Insurance; Regulated Industries; Rules; Transportation and Ways & Means. He also served as the House Majority Caucus Chairman for eight years and is the current House Majority Caucus Chair. Bruce has been recognized as the Technology Association of Georgia’s Legislator of the Year (twice), the Georgia Chamber Legislator of the Year, and he has also received the National Federation of Independent Business (NIFB) Guardian of Small Business Award. His legislative focus is tax policy and business and job development. He is passionate about supporting Georgia business, as well as reducing taxes and keeping Georgia small businesses competitive. As Chairman of the Income Tax Subcommittee of Ways & Means, he has helped pass legislation creating the current Georgia Flat Income tax as well as income tax cuts.
